Fua faʻavae puipuia

  • Fai se meaʻai taumafa sufficient vitamin B12. The vegan can find vitamin B12 in fefete fortified with B12 (Red Star, Lyfe), fortified soy beverages, fortified rice beverages and imitation meats (often based on soy protein).
  • The best sources of vitamin B12:

    – offal (beef, pork, veal, poultry liver, kidneys, brain, etc.);

    – meat, poultry, fish and seafood;

    – eggs and dairy products.
